Forms from staff who leave the company, either transfer ownership to a group prior to leaving or admins can follow this https://support.office.com/en-us/article/transfer-ownership-of-a-form-921a6361-a4e5-44ea-bce9-c4ed63aa54b4?ui=en-US&rs=en-US&ad=US if the owner has left the organisation already, transferring the ownership by using a special URL which displays their forms:
Admin section for Forms, this tells you how to access available settings - https://support.office.com/en-gb/article/administrator-settings-for-microsoft-forms-48161c55-fbae-4f37-8951-9e3befc0248b.
Jay L - are you using Forms or Forms Pro? If Forms Pro, the data is stored in the Common Data Service, there is currently no 'admin' area at this time, but hopefully something in the future.
